mirror of
https://github.com/panda3d/panda3d.git
synced 2025-10-04 02:42:49 -04:00
move from Gtk-- 1.x to gtk+-2.0
This commit is contained in:
parent
8567173ece
commit
9f2768dfed
@ -622,10 +622,10 @@
|
|||||||
#define CHROMIUM_LIBS spuload
|
#define CHROMIUM_LIBS spuload
|
||||||
#defer HAVE_CHROMIUM $[libtest $[CHROMIUM_LPATH],$[CHROMIUM_LIBS]]
|
#defer HAVE_CHROMIUM $[libtest $[CHROMIUM_LPATH],$[CHROMIUM_LIBS]]
|
||||||
|
|
||||||
// Is Gtk-- installed? How should we run the gtkmm-config program?
|
// Is gtk+-2 installed? This is only needed to build the pstats
|
||||||
// This matters only to programs in PANDATOOL.
|
// program on Unix (or non-Windows) platforms.
|
||||||
#define GTKMM_CONFIG gtkmm-config
|
#define PKG_CONFIG pkg-config
|
||||||
#defer HAVE_GTKMM $[bintest $[GTKMM_CONFIG]]
|
#define HAVE_GTK
|
||||||
|
|
||||||
// Do we have Freetype 2.0 (or better)? If available, this package is
|
// Do we have Freetype 2.0 (or better)? If available, this package is
|
||||||
// used to generate dynamic in-the-world text from font files.
|
// used to generate dynamic in-the-world text from font files.
|
||||||
|
@ -236,8 +236,8 @@
|
|||||||
#set CHROMIUM_LIBS $[CHROMIUM_LIBS]
|
#set CHROMIUM_LIBS $[CHROMIUM_LIBS]
|
||||||
#set HAVE_CHROMIUM $[HAVE_CHROMIUM]
|
#set HAVE_CHROMIUM $[HAVE_CHROMIUM]
|
||||||
|
|
||||||
#set GTKMM_CONFIG $[GTKMM_CONFIG]
|
#set PKG_CONFIG $[PKG_CONFIG]
|
||||||
#set HAVE_GTKMM $[HAVE_GTKMM]
|
#set HAVE_GTK $[HAVE_GTK]
|
||||||
|
|
||||||
#set FREETYPE_CONFIG $[FREETYPE_CONFIG]
|
#set FREETYPE_CONFIG $[FREETYPE_CONFIG]
|
||||||
#set HAVE_FREETYPE $[HAVE_FREETYPE]
|
#set HAVE_FREETYPE $[HAVE_FREETYPE]
|
||||||
@ -255,14 +255,14 @@
|
|||||||
|
|
||||||
|
|
||||||
// Now infer a few more variables based on what was defined.
|
// Now infer a few more variables based on what was defined.
|
||||||
#if $[and $[HAVE_GTKMM],$[GTKMM_CONFIG]]
|
#if $[and $[HAVE_GTK],$[PKG_CONFIG]]
|
||||||
#define cflags $[shell $[GTKMM_CONFIG] --cflags]
|
#define cflags $[shell $[PKG_CONFIG] gtk+-2.0 --cflags]
|
||||||
#define libs $[shell $[GTKMM_CONFIG] --libs]
|
#define libs $[shell $[PKG_CONFIG] gtk+-2.0 --libs]
|
||||||
|
|
||||||
#define GTKMM_CFLAGS $[filter-out -I%,$[cflags]]
|
#define GTK_CFLAGS $[filter-out -I%,$[cflags]]
|
||||||
#define GTKMM_IPATH $[unique $[patsubst -I%,%,$[filter -I%,$[cflags]]]]
|
#define GTK_IPATH $[unique $[patsubst -I%,%,$[filter -I%,$[cflags]]]]
|
||||||
#define GTKMM_LPATH $[unique $[patsubst -L%,%,$[filter -L%,$[libs]]]]
|
#define GTK_LPATH $[unique $[patsubst -L%,%,$[filter -L%,$[libs]]]]
|
||||||
#define GTKMM_LIBS $[patsubst -l%,%,$[filter -l%,$[libs]]]
|
#define GTK_LIBS $[patsubst -l%,%,$[filter -l%,$[libs]]]
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#if $[and $[HAVE_FREETYPE],$[FREETYPE_CONFIG]]
|
#if $[and $[HAVE_FREETYPE],$[FREETYPE_CONFIG]]
|
||||||
|
@ -258,11 +258,11 @@
|
|||||||
#define mikmod_libs $[MIKMOD_LIBS]
|
#define mikmod_libs $[MIKMOD_LIBS]
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#if $[HAVE_GTKMM]
|
#if $[HAVE_GTK]
|
||||||
#define gtkmm_ipath $[wildcard $[GTKMM_IPATH]]
|
#define gtk_ipath $[wildcard $[GTK_IPATH]]
|
||||||
#define gtkmm_lpath $[wildcard $[GTKMM_LPATH]]
|
#define gtk_lpath $[wildcard $[GTK_LPATH]]
|
||||||
#define gtkmm_cflags $[GTKMM_CFLAGS]
|
#define gtk_cflags $[GTK_CFLAGS]
|
||||||
#define gtkmm_libs $[GTKMM_LIBS]
|
#define gtk_libs $[GTK_LIBS]
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#if $[HAVE_FREETYPE]
|
#if $[HAVE_FREETYPE]
|
||||||
|
Loading…
x
Reference in New Issue
Block a user